Rigoberti is a masculine name of Germanic origin, derived from the elements 'rik' meaning 'ruler' or 'king' and 'berht' meaning 'bright' or 'famous.' Historically, the name conveys the idea of a renowned or illustrious leader, often associated with nobility and strength. It has been used in Spanish-speaking cultures as a variant of Rigoberto.

Rigoberto Cabezas

Nicaraguan general and politician influential in early 20th century politics.

Rigobert Bonne

French cartographer known for his detailed 18th-century maps.

Rigoberto López Pérez

Nicaraguan poet and revolutionary martyr who opposed dictatorship.
